App Review: Christmas with Weezer

Tap Tap to Weezer Versions of Popular Christmas Songs

Weezer has come to the iPhone in time for the holidays, unfortunately it has been given the Tap Tap treatment.

Tap Tap has always fallen short when it came to transcribing notes. It lacks the refined Guitar Hero or Rock Band feel where notes actually have some semblance of rhythm.

The place where Tap Tap excels is in it’s multi-player mode and it’s ability to acquire such talent as Weezer and Nine Inch Nails.

There are six songs remixed masterfully by Weezer:

O Come All Ye Faithful
We Wish You a Merry Christmas
Silent Night
Hark the Herald Angel Sings
O Holy Nigh
The First Noel

Along with two Bonus Tracks:

Pork and Beans
The Greatest Man That Ever Lived

Conclusion:
If you simply must have a Christmas album this year and do not want to shell out the extra dough for Sufjan Stevens, then this is the album to own.

The game play, although ineffably unrefined is still enjoyable when you are waiting for food with a friend. The magic will inevitably dwindle after the holidays, as will it’s price tag.
